Visual Study Techniques

Although many learners grasp complex chemistry concepts through traditional approaches, imagery-based instruction can significantly enhance understanding for those who excel with imagery and spatial reasoning. Tutors can include visual representations, molecular models, and charts to illustrate chemical reactions and formations, making theoretical concepts more tangible. Utilizing color-coded notes and dynamic simulations can also engage visual learners, helping them to picture mechanisms like bonding or reaction mechanisms. Additionally, integrating visual recordings that show laboratory work or real-world applications of chemistry can provide context and boost memory. By modifying their approaches to include these visual elements, tutors can create a more inclusive learning environment, catering to diverse learning styles and ultimately promoting a more profound understanding of chemistry concepts among their students.

What Does Chemistry Tutoring Typically Cost?

Chemistry tutoring classes typically range from $30 to $100 per hour, based on factors such as the tutor's expertise, area, and session length. Rates may vary widely depending on specific situations and particular requirements.
